Sauna stove and method for replacing a heating device of such a sauna stove
The sauna heater design enables easy installation and replacement of heating elements through automatic plug engagement and positioning, addressing the complexity of conventional sauna heater maintenance.

Conventional sauna heaters require time-consuming and labor-intensive assembly and disassembly of heating elements, necessitating a qualified electrician for connection to the power source.
A sauna heater design featuring a housing with an opening for easy insertion of a heating device, an electrical connector with automatic plug engagement, and a positioning arrangement to ensure correct alignment, allowing for easy installation and replacement by a single technician.
Facilitates quick and straightforward maintenance and replacement of heating elements without the need for specialized electrical knowledge, reducing installation time and complexity.

[0001] The present invention relates to a sauna heater comprising a housing, a heating element, and an electrical connector. The invention further relates to a method for replacing the heating element of such a sauna heater.
[0002] Sauna heaters are known in various designs from the prior art. These known sauna heaters typically consist of a housing and a heating element located within the housing. During assembly, the heating element is installed in the housing and connected to a power source via wiring, such as a terminal block.
[0003] With conventional sauna heaters, assembling and disassembling the heating element is therefore time-consuming and labor-intensive. In particular, a qualified electrician is required to disconnect and connect the heating element to the power source.
[0004] The object of the present invention is to provide a sauna heater which allows for easy maintenance and replacement of a heating element by a single technician. Furthermore, the object of the present invention is to provide a method for replacing a heating element of such a sauna heater.
[0005] This problem is solved according to the invention by the sauna stove with the features of claim 1 and the method with the features of claim 10.
[0006] According to the invention, a sauna heater is provided, comprising a housing, a heating device, and an electrical connector. The electrical connector has a plug element arranged on the heating device and a mating plug element located inside the housing. The housing includes an opening for the heating device. The heating device can be inserted into the housing through this opening in such a way that the plug element engages with the mating plug element, in particular automatically.
[0007] The core idea of the invention is therefore to provide a heating device opening in the housing, which allows the heating device to be easily inserted into the housing. The electrical connector is designed such that the plug element automatically engages with the mating plug element when the heating device is located inside the housing. Thus, when the heating device is inserted into the housing, it is automatically connected to a power source via the plug connection, without the need for a qualified electrician to connect the heating device to a power source. The heating device is therefore easy to install.
[0008] In an exemplary embodiment of the sauna heater according to the invention, the heating device and thus also the plug-in element arranged on the heating device can be removed or taken out of the housing through the heating device opening.
[0009] In an exemplary embodiment of the sauna stove according to the invention, the heating device opening can be closed with a cover.
[0010] The cover can be moved and / or swivelled relative to the housing.
[0011] The cover can be fixed to the heating device or to the housing.
[0012] In a preferred embodiment, the sauna heater according to the invention comprises a positioning arrangement for positioning the heating device relative to the housing.
[0013] The positioning arrangement is designed, for example, such that the plug-in element is engaged with the plug-in counterpart element when the heating device is inserted into the housing.
[0014] The positioning arrangement makes it possible, for example, to guide the movement of the heating device relative to the housing when inserting the heating device into the housing and / or to limit the relative movement of the heating device to the housing.
[0015] The positioning arrangement can therefore be designed such that the heating device, when it is completely arranged in the housing, is in a defined position relative to the housing in which the plug-in element is engaged with the plug-in counterpart element.
[0016] The positioning arrangement can include a positioning element and a positioning counter element.
[0017] The positioning element is, for example, fixed to the heating device.
[0018] The positioning counter element can be connected to the housing, in particular fixed directly to the housing.
[0019] For example, the positioning element or the positioning counter element is a positioning pin and the positioning counter element or the positioning element is a positioning hole, in particular in the form of a blind hole.
[0020] The positioning arrangement may also be or include a stop element against which the heating device rests when it is completely enclosed in the housing.
[0021] In an exemplary embodiment, the sauna heater according to the invention comprises a rail system.
[0022] The rail system can have at least one, in particular two or a plurality, guide or running rail(s) connected to the housing and at least one, in particular two or a plurality, guide element(s) guided in the guide or running rail(s).
[0023] The guide elements can be or include running elements, sliding pieces or sliders and / or (sliding) carriages.
[0024] In an exemplary embodiment of the sauna heater according to the invention, the heating device is movable between an extended position, in which the heating device is arranged outside the housing, and an installed position by means of the rail system. In the installed position, the heating device is completely arranged inside the housing and the plug-in element is engaged with the mating plug-in element.
[0025] For example, the cover is directly or indirectly connected to the rail system, in particular to the guide elements, in a manner that is immovable relative to the guide elements.
[0026] In a preferred embodiment, the sauna heater according to the invention comprises a receiving element which can be moved by means of the rail system and on which the heating arrangement can be placed.
[0027] The receiving element can be designed in a plate-like form.
[0028] In an exemplary embodiment of the sauna heater according to the invention, the positioning arrangement is designed such that the heating device can be arranged in exactly one defined position on the receiving element.
[0029] In a preferred embodiment of the sauna stove according to the invention, the heating device opening is formed on a side wall or on the top of the housing.
[0030] The heating device can therefore be inserted into and removed from the housing, for example, by translational movement in a horizontal or vertical direction relative to the housing.
[0031] The sauna heater may also include a guide system that allows for a defined insertion of the heating device from above, i.e. by moving it in a vertical direction, in particular through an opening in the housing.
[0032] In an exemplary embodiment of the sauna heater according to the invention, the housing includes a base plate.
[0033] The heating device, for example, can be moved translationally on the base plate.
[0034] The heating device can be removed from the base plate by movement relative to the base plate in a vertical direction.
[0035] The heating device can be mounted on the base plate so that it can be moved along exactly one horizontal axis. This allows the heating device to be easily inserted into and removed from the housing.
[0036] The axis of movement extends, for example, through the heating device opening.
[0037] In an exemplary embodiment, the sauna stove according to the invention comprises an insert for receiving heat storage materials, such as sauna stones, lava stones, soapstone or the like.
[0038] The housing can be designed to be open at the top or to have an opening for insertion, so that the insert can be inserted into and removed from the housing.
[0039] The insertion opening can correspond to the heating device opening.
[0040] The insert is connected to at least one handle element. The handle element allows for easy insertion and removal of the insert from inside the housing.
[0041] In an exemplary embodiment, the sauna heater according to the invention comprises a steam generation device which includes at least one liquid receiving container. The liquid contained in the liquid receiving container can be vaporized by means of the heating device.
[0042] Furthermore, a method for replacing a heating device of a sauna heater, particularly as described above, is provided.
[0043] The process includes the following steps: (a) removing a heating device from the housing through a heating device opening in the housing, and (b) inserting another heating device into the housing through the heating device opening.
[0044] For example, by removing the heating device from the housing according to step (a), a contact between a plug element located on the heating device and a plug counterpart located in the housing is automatically released.
[0045] The other heating device is, for example, identical in construction to the heating device.
[0046] By inserting the additional heating device into the housing according to step (b), contact can automatically be established between an additional plug element arranged on the additional heating device and the corresponding plug element arranged in the housing.
[0047] The mating connector, for example, forms an electrical connector or another electrical connector together with the connector and the other connector.
[0048] Step (a) is carried out, for example, by translational movement of the heating device relative to the housing, in particular in a horizontal and / or vertical direction.
[0049] For example, before step (a) the heating device opening is opened.
[0050] In particular, this involves, for example, removing or moving a cover that closes the heating device opening so that the heating device opening is exposed.
[0051] For this purpose, the cover is moved translationally and / or pivoted around a pivot axis extending in a vertical or horizontal direction.
[0052] After step (b), the heating device opening can be closed, for example, by means of the cover or another cover.
[0053] For example, the cover is fixed to the heating device before step (a) and / or the cover or another cover is fixed to the further heating device before step (b).
[0054] If the cover is fixed to the heating device and / or the cover or the further cover is fixed to the further heating device, the heating device opening is automatically opened by removing the heating device from the housing or closed by inserting the further heating device into the housing according to step (b).
[0055] For example, in step (b) the additional heating device is placed on a rail system.
[0056] The procedure may further include removing an insert for holding heat storage media from a housing of the sauna heater and subsequently inserting another insert into the housing.
[0057] For example, the insert is removed from the housing through an opening in the housing.
[0058] The remaining insert can be inserted into the housing through the insert opening.

[0060] In the Figures 1 to 3 A sauna heater 2 according to the invention is shown. The sauna heater 2 comprises a housing 4, a replaceable heating device 6 and a replaceable insert 8.
[0061] During the Figures 1 to 3 In the illustrated embodiment of the sauna heater 2, the housing 4 is open on one side, forming a heating element opening. The heating element 6 can be inserted into and removed from the interior of the housing 4, or into a cavity defined by the housing 4, through this opening. The heating element 6 can thus be easily replaced through the heating element opening 26, particularly without requiring the disassembly of other components of the sauna heater 2. The heating element opening 26 can be closed, for example, by means of a cover.
[0062] As from Figure 2 As can be seen, the heating device 6 comprises a plurality of serpentine heating elements 34. The heating elements are connected to a connecting cable or power cable via an electrical plug connection. The connecting cable can in turn be connected to a power source.
[0063] The connector comprises a plug element 22 and a mating plug element 24. The plug element 22 is fixedly connected to the heating device 6. In particular, the plug element 22 is fixed to an underside of the heating device 6. The mating plug element 24 is fixedly connected to the housing 4, in particular its position relative to the housing 4 is secured. For example, the mating plug element 24 is fixed to a base plate 42 that closes the bottom of the housing vertically. The plug element 22 and the mating plug element 24 are aligned with each other such that the plug element 22 can be brought into engagement with the mating plug element 24 by a movement relative to the mating plug element 24 in a horizontal direction.
[0064] In an installation position of the heating device 6, which is in Figure 1 As shown, the plug-in element 22 is engaged with the plug-in counterpart element 24.
[0065] To ensure correct positioning of the heating device 6 relative to the housing 4 in the installation position, the housing 4 includes a positioning arrangement. The positioning arrangement comprises a positioning element that is fixedly connected to or forms part of the heating device 6 and a positioning counter-element. The positioning counter-element is secured in its position relative to the housing 4. In particular, the positioning counter-element is fixedly connected to or forms part of the housing 4.
[0066] The housing 4 is open at its top, i.e., in the vertical direction at the top, so that an insert opening 14 is formed. The insert 8 can be inserted into the housing 4 from above through the insert opening 14. Heat storage elements (not shown) can be arranged in the insert 8. The insert 8 can be inserted into the housing 4 until it rests on the heating device 6.
[0067] In contrast to the embodiment shown, it is also conceivable that the insert 8 can be inserted so far into the housing 4 that the insert 8 rests on a support element firmly connected to the housing 4.
[0068] When the insert 8 comes to rest against the heating device 6 or the support element, the insert 8 is completely enclosed within the housing 4. The insert 8 therefore does not protrude from the top of the housing 4.
[0069] In contrast to the embodiment shown, it is also conceivable that the insert comprises a lateral projection or flange which rests on the housing, in particular such that the insert is arranged at least largely, in particular the area of the insert in which the heat storage means 12 are arranged, in the housing.
[0070] To facilitate insertion and removal of the insert 8 into and from the housing 4, the insert 8 is connected to two handle elements 10. Each handle element 10 has an angular, inverted U-shape. The handle elements 10 thus each comprise two legs 16 and a transverse element 18 connecting the legs 16 at their ends.
[0071] The legs 16 are each connected to the insert 8 in such a way that they can be displaced by a defined distance relative to the insert 8, particularly in the vertical direction. Thus, when the insert 8 is installed in the housing 4 in its intended functional position, the handle elements 10 can be arranged completely inside the housing 4; that is, the handle elements 10 do not protrude from the top of the housing 4.
[0072] In the Figures 4 to 6 Another sauna heater 20 according to the invention is shown. The further sauna heater 20 essentially corresponds to the one shown in the Figures 1 to 3The sauna heater shown in section 2. Therefore, only the distinguishing features will be explained below, while the above statements apply accordingly.
[0073] As can be seen particularly from the Figures 5 and 6 As can be seen, the other sauna heater 20 differs from the one in the Figures 1 to 3 The sauna heater 2 shown is distinguished by the fact that the heating element 6 can be inserted into the housing from above, i.e., not from the side as with sauna heater 2. The insertion opening 14 thus simultaneously forms an opening for the heating element.
[0074] While sauna heater 2 comprises the plug-in element 22 and the plug-in counterpart element 24, which can be engaged and detached from each other by a relative movement in a horizontal direction, the other sauna heater 20 comprises a plug-in element 26 and a plug-in counterpart element 28. The plug-in element 26 and the plug-in counterpart element 28 can be engaged and detached from each other by a relative movement in a vertical direction.
